It is said that comedy is to tear up worthless things for people to see, and the director uses this feature in a subtle and interesting way. It's not that the things he presents are ugly, they're just things that everyone knows and won't show. For example, if a person fails in his career, his wife runs away with others, he is down and out, and others who have nothing to do with him will not secretly make fun of himself, or secretly rejoice, or just make fun of it outright. The director directly visualized this, with rows of people sitting in the station clapping and laughing. However, the most peculiar thing in this scene is the way of flashbacks, directly through the TV in the station back to Taozi's childhood, the medium of TV can reflect the mentality of others watching the play.
If there is a movie that you can remember without watching the plot, it must be from director Tetsuya Nakajima. The director's video style is really gorgeous and outstanding. The colors are bright and intricate, interspersed with a large number of CG animations, all kinds of surrealistic imaginations are also wonderful and dreamy, the characters in the images are also very cute, the performances are super exaggerated, life is like a play, we can use a humorous , relaxed posture to perform and walk.
